Poland’s Jan Błachowicz overcame the previously unbeaten Israel Adesanya to retain his world light-heavyweight MMA title at the Ultimate Fighting Championship 259 in Las Vegas on Sunday.

In what was described as the most anticipated clash of the year, the 38-year-old Pole scored a unanimous points decision in his favour: 49-46, 49-45 and 49-45.

It was the first defeat inflicted on 31-year-old Adesanya, the Nigeria-born middleweight king of New Zealand, who was looking to become the fifth double-weight world champion in UFC history.

Błachowicz came into the fight as the underdog. He managed to bounce back from a slow start and began to take control in the fourth round when a big left hander and a takedown saw him keep Adesanya under wraps on the ground.

He had Adesanya down again in the fifth for a sustained period of pressure that put the decision beyond doubt.

“Now I think I deserve some respect. I’m the true champion right now,” a triumphant Błachowicz said after the fight.
